The successful candidate will possess a broad range of technical skills, but predominantly will have a working understanding of Citrix, Virtualisation (VMWare) Microsoft, and Backup technologies. They will be used to working in a busy and dynamic environment, and have excellent troubleshooting and problem solving skills. They should have considerable commercial experience in a similar technical role, ideally in the Financial or Banking sectors.
Responsibilities:
* Work to pre-defined processes and procedures.
* Perform daily system health-checks.
* Monitoring of systems and escalating to 3rd line support, where appropriate.
* Liaise with 3rd party (external) maintenance suppliers.
* Participate in an out-of-hours 24/7 on-call rota.
They will be responsible for maintaining and monitoring the day-to-day aspects of the IT Infrastructure; they must possess the following skills.
* Citrix XenApp6.5 admin and configuration experience.
* Citrix XenDesktop 5 admin and configuration experience.
* Citrix Provisioning Services admin and configuration experience including vDisk maintenance.
* Citrix Netscaler 10 VPX Access Gateway Admin experience.
* Vmware vSphere 5.0 Admin experience.
* Microsoft 2008 R2 OS experience
* App-v 4.6 Sequencing and admin experience.
* Prior experience of working in large/complex corporate multi-site environments.
* Exposure to Microsoft Technologies (Microsoft 2008 R2)
* Have a good understanding of TCP/IP.
In addition to the technical skills detailed above, the candidate should also:
* Hold a current foundation Microsoft, VMware or Cisco networking qualification (i.e. MCSE/VCP)
* Ability to communicate well with both IT and business staff and departments.
* Identify work required and organise, facilitate and perform the work with limited guidance from line management.
* Good analytical skills and methodical approach.
* Highly organised.
* Strong Service attitude.
* Commitment to quality and continuous improvement.
* The ability to support a customer in the understanding if the ITIL structure and process.
* Extensive understanding of Service Level Agreements.
* Knowledge and use of helpdesk management software.
The following skills are considered desirable:
* Exposure to Database and Web technologies.
* Experience of working with Blade-server technology (ideally the Cisco UCS platform).
* Exposure to EMC storage platforms (ideally CX4 or later).
